The general object of the service is the provision of security services in the context of trade fairs, exhibitions, congresses and other events of Koelnmesse GmbH and Koelncongress GmbH as well as other companies in the halls, passages, transitions, entrances and in the open-air area on the grounds of Koelnmesse.
These are the event security and order service, the fire security guard service, the explosives detection, the investigation service and the medical service.
Security and order service at the North Exhibition Centre (Halls 6, 7, 8, 9, 10.1, 10.2, CC-North and North Entrance Middle Boulevard, North Boulevard)According to § 43 SBauVO, the operator must set up a security service as required by the event. The security service is responsible for the operational safety measures. The security service must be under the direction of a security officer at events.
The terms security service and security service are often used interchangeably when holding events. For a better differentiation, the terms event security service (VSD) for persons with tasks according to § 34a Trade Regulation Act (GewO) and event order service (VOD) for all other persons are therefore used in the following.
The advertised positions will be used during set-up and dismantling times and during events.
In particular, the Contractor is instructed to ensure general safety at trade fairs and events within the framework of the general traffic safety obligations and the special obligations as the operator of a place of assembly in the halls, passages, transitions, entrances and in the outdoor area used.
The highest level of safety must be guaranteed for all exhibitors, stand builders and visitors. They are to be provided with competent advice and support in matters of safety across all phases of an event. The aim is to give them the feeling of maximum security during their stay. Special consideration must be given to the needs of people with disabilities and international guests.
The Contractor must deploy and provide personnel accordingly for this purpose. In addition to carrying out security tasks, it must also be able to provide qualified information and assistance.
The provisions of the Umbrella and Wage Collective Agreement for the Security and Security Industry of North Rhine-Westphalia and the provisions of the Collective Agreement on the Regulation of Minimum Wages for Security Services in the currently valid version apply.
The regulations of the current version DIN 77200-1:2022-10 and DIN 77200-2:2020-07 (Security services (SDL) for events with special safety relevance) (hereinafter referred to as DIN 77200) and DIN EN 15602:2008 continue to apply to the lot.

Fire safety guard serviceThe fire safety guard service is responsible for the early detection of a possible fire and the initiation of appropriate countermeasures during the event.
A fire safety guard service in accordance with § 41 SBauVO is commissioned and appointed by Koelnmesse.
Koelnmesse has received a decision from the Cologne professional fire brigade to carry out the fire safety watch with its own forces.
The deployment of forces is planned on the basis of the risk assessment and coordinated with the responsible authorities.
For the implementation of the fire safety watch service, the vfdb leaflet MB 13-06 is used.
Explosives DetectionFor the qualified handling of abandoned objects, an explosives detection facility is regularly provided on standby at events on the exhibition grounds.
Primarily, this is a dog handler with two explosives detection dogs (SSH).
If suspicious objects are found, the explosives detection department is alerted by Koelnmesse's Security Group, the Situation Centre or the Security Centre.
The discovery area is cordoned off and secured by the existing forces. The explosives detection team must arrive at the scene within 10 minutes to examine the object. It must be possible to confirm or rule out a suspicion on site without any action on the object and without significant waiting times. If the suspicion is confirmed, further measures will be taken by the police.
The explosives detection or the dog handler with the SSH will be used throughout the exhibition grounds in the area of all lots.
The decision to commission explosives detection is made on a trade fair-by-trade fair basis after a risk assessment.
It is possible to call up for guest events.
Disruptions to the course of events must be kept to a minimum. In such operations, the Contractor must cooperate closely with Koelnmesse's Security Group and, if necessary, with the state security services such as the police, etc.
Investigative ServiceThe investigation service performs prevention, observation and administrative tasks during the set-up phase, during a trade fair and during the dismantling phase. During these phases, among other things, counselling services (theft prevention) as well as support and recording of injured persons/property/organisations must be carried out. The management of lost property/stolen goods is also the responsibility of the team deployed. The Investigation Service supports law enforcement authorities, e.g. in plagiarism investigations. In addition, documentation in the event of property damage and accidents is part of the tasks.
Medical serviceThe ambulance service is responsible for medical emergency response at events on the Koelnmesse grounds. The main task is to relieve the regular ambulance service in the case of minor injuries and illnesses and to shorten the treatment-free interval in medical emergencies. In medical emergencies that require further treatment in hospital, the emergency services are alerted immediately, in a targeted manner and the patient is admitted to the scene.
In less severe cases, further treatment of patients may be required in Koelnmesse's medical centres. Transports to the medical centres on the exhibition grounds are the responsibility of the medical service. The Medical Centres also serve as a point of contact for the treatment of minor injuries and illnesses. The tasks arising in this context must be carried out by the personnel deployed within the framework of their respective qualifications.
All internal emergency calls on the exhibition grounds are made at Koelnmesse's security centre. The security centre receives the emergency calls and forwards the reports to the medical service. If necessary, further measures or alarms are initiated by the security centre in accordance with emergency management.
The implementation of emergency transports to hospitals is the exclusive responsibility of the regular ambulance service. The ambulance service coordinates with the control centre and coordinates possible transfer points on the Koelnmesse site.
The doctors employed are not part of this call for tenders.
